* bitbake: bitbake: runqueue: add memory pressure regulationAryaman Gupta2022-08-231-5/+22
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Prevent new tasks from being scheduled if the memory pressure is above a certain threshold, specified through the "BB_MAX_PRESSURE_MEMORY" variable in the conf/local.conf file. This is an extension to the following commit and hence regulates pressure in the same way: 48a6d84de1 bitbake: runqueue: add cpu/io pressure regulation Memory pressure is experienced when time is spent swapping, refaulting pages from the page cache or performing direct reclaim. This is why memory pressure is rarely seen but might be useful as a last resort to prevent OOM errors. * bitbake: bitbake: runqueue: add cpu/io pressure regulationAryaman Gupta2022-08-231-0/+65
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Prevent the scheduler from starting new tasks if the current cpu or io pressure is above a certain threshold and there is at least one active task. This threshold can be specified through the "BB_PRESSURE_MAX_{CPU|IO}" variables in conf/local.conf. The threshold represents the difference in "total" pressure from the previous second. The pressure data is discussed in this oe-core commit: 061931520b buildstats.py: enable collection of /proc/pressure data where one can see that the average and "total" values are available. From tests, it was seen that while using the averaged data was somewhat useful, the latency in regulating builds was too high. By taking the difference between the current pressure and the pressure seen in the previous second, better regulation occurs. Using a shorter time period is appealing but due to fluctations in pressure, comparing the current pressure to 1 second ago achieves a reasonable compromise. One can look at the buildstats logs, that usually sample once per second, to decide a sensible threshold. If the thresholds aren't specified, pressure is not monitored and hence there is no impact on build times. Arbitary lower limit of 1.0 results in a fatal error to avoid extremely long builds. If the limits are higher than 1,000,000, then warnings are issued to inform users that the specified limit is very high and unlikely to result in any regulation. The current bitbake scheduling algorithm requires that at least one task be active. This means that if high pressure is seen, then new tasks will not be started and pressure will be checked only for as long as at least one task is active. When there are no active tasks, an additional task will be started and pressure checking resumed. This behaviour means that if an external source is causing the pressure to exceed the threshold, bitbake will continue to make some progress towards the requested target. This violates the intent of limiting pressure but, given the current scheduling algorithm as described above, there seems to be no other option. In the case where only one bitbake build is running, the implications of the scheduler requirement will likely result in pressure being higher than the threshold. More work would be required to ensure that the pressure threshold is never exceeded, for example by adding pressure monitoring to make and ninja. * relocate_sdk.py: ensure interpreter size error causes relocation to failPaul Eggleton2022-08-231-2/+8
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| If there is insufficent space to change the interpreter, we were printing an error here but the overall script did not return an error code, and thus the SDK installation appeared to succeed - but some of the binaries will not be in a working state. Allow the relocation to proceed (so we still get a full list of the failures) but error out at the end so that the installation is halted.
